The United States House of Representatives elections in California, 1950 was an election for California's delegation to the United States House of Representatives, which occurred as part of the general election of the House of Representatives on November 7, 1950. Republicans won one Democratic-held seat.
United States House of Representatives elections in California, 1950 | ||||||
---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
Party | Votes | % | Before | After | +/– | |
Republican | 1,754,001 | 52.2% | 12 | 13 | +1 | |
Democratic | 1,480,639 | 44.1% | 11 | 10 | -1 | |
Progressive | 105,396 | 3.1% | 0 | 0 | 0 | |
Prohibition | 10,339 | 0.3% | 0 | 0 | 0 | |
Independent | 7,329 | 0.2% | 0 | 0 | 0 | |
Totals | 3,357,704 | 100.0% | 23 | 23 | — |
